The latest book in the series that won the Sankei Juvenile Literature Publishing Culture Award*JR Award!
The time is the Heian period, in the capital of Kyoto. Sadamichi, a lord, meets a man named Ensuke who has come to Tokyo. Tousuke receives a small box from a woman at the foot of a bridge and says he is going to deliver it to a destination in Kyoto. The box is not supposed to be opened, but the two happen to look inside. They find a ball of light inside. Meanwhile, Hazuki, a white fox who has come to help Sadamichi through a mysterious connection, is serving the princess, whom she considers like a younger sister. However, when Nakamitsu no Kimi, an older wife who strictly educates the princess, arrives, she begins to develop a rivalry with her in some way. Eventually, Tousuke, who was assigned to work at the princess's mansion, became enchanted by Tama, and perhaps because of Tama's influence, Hazuki also wielded unexpected power. Sadamichi manages to get Tama's small box to the rightful recipient. This is the third installment of a Heian-period fantasy depicting the relationship between ayakashi and people.
